Transaction 89a41a685cd12bef791ff9f84336dc2817b8a9d9790b946a7ab71a2f2f20a978
1 Input
2 Outputs
- 89a41a685cd12bef791ff9f84336dc2817b8a9d9790b946a7ab71a2f2f20a978:0
- 89a41a685cd12bef791ff9f84336dc2817b8a9d9790b946a7ab71a2f2f20a978:1
value 720500
address 1NQvikvhaQPMesMHDpuxdw8Pk4PPXijWx
value 190232586
address 1DNbevfgRdByVETFvvBsSbvmKNhxPCpuTQ